Home
/
Tutorials
/
Getting started with AI
/

Struggling with godot engine? here's how to get started

Navigating Godot: Users Express Frustration with Engine Complexity | Tips & Solutions Uncovered

By

Aisha Nasser

Nov 28, 2025, 12:40 PM

2 minutes needed to read

A person sits at a computer, exploring the Godot Engine interface with coding and game design elements visible on the screen.

A growing number of individuals are voicing their challenges when using the Godot game engine, particularly regarding plugin installations and coding in C++. Users report a steep learning curve, noting a lack of accessible tutorials and resources can add confusion to the mix.

Users Push Back on Complexity

Some forum contributors highlight difficulties in understanding Godot's features. "Iโ€™m installing a plugin and I donโ€™t know how to use it," one commenter noted. Specific plugins mentioned include Road Generator and Advanced Characters 3D.

Many users suggest it might be premature to tackle complex tasks without a firm grasp of the basics.

"It sounds a bit like youโ€™re trying to put the cart before the horse," remarked one user.

The Language Dilemma

Frustration persists over programming languages supported by Godot. Although C++ is technically supported, users are finding it cumbersome for beginners.

Comments from experienced users recommend starting with GDScript instead. "Most tutorials and documentation are written for GDScript," one noted, advising beginners to familiarize themselves with this language first.

Focus on Resources

Various community insights suggest utilizing existing resources:

  • Brackeyโ€™s Godot Tutorials: Highly rated for newcomers.

  • GDQuest: Offers comprehensive learning paths.

  • Godot Documentation: Covers the fundamental aspects and various programming languages available within the engine.

One user emphasized, "C++ requires a deeper understanding of Godot before diving in."

Key Insights in User Comments

  • โšก Users recommend GDScript over C++ for beginners.

  • ๐Ÿ” Difficulty arises from trying to use advanced plugins without proper guidance.

  • ๐Ÿ’ก Many suggest starting with basic resources such as tutorials and the documentation.

Interestingly, the consensus leans heavily toward supporting new users with tutorials that cater to GDScript, minimizing frustration along the learning curve. With the right resources, it seems possible for newcomers to master Godot and utilize its extensive capabilities.

Shaping Tomorrow's Game Development Path

There's a strong chance that as more individuals voice their concerns, developers of the Godot engine will prioritize ease-of-use features and more beginner-friendly documentation. With a heightened focus on community feedback, we may see an increase in resources tailored to newcomers, potentially improving the adoption rate by as much as 30% within the next year. Experts estimate around half of new users might switch to GDScript, further prompting updates to plugins and tutorials that cater to this more accessible path. As this transition gains traction, expect a more vibrant community as collaboration flourishes among those learning together.

Lessons from the Silent Movie Era

This situation resembles the challenges faced in the silent film era when filmmakers struggled to convey complex narratives without sound. Just as directors adapted by simplifying storytelling and enhancing visual techniques, the Godot community may evolve by clarifying essential features and better aligning resources with beginnersโ€™ needs. In both instances, navigating early frustrations ultimately leads to refinement and growth, fostering a more inclusive environment that encourages exploration and creativity.